What Are the Key Features That Make a Petrol Leaf Blower the Best?

The key features that define the best petrol leaf blower include:

  • Powerful Engine: A robust engine is crucial for effective leaf blowing, providing the necessary airspeed and volume to clear debris efficiently. Typically, a higher cc (cubic centimeters) rating indicates a more powerful engine, allowing for faster and more effective operation.
  • Lightweight Design: A lightweight design enhances maneuverability and reduces user fatigue during extended use. The best petrol leaf blowers balance power and weight, making them easier to handle without sacrificing performance.
  • Variable Speed Control: Variable speed settings allow users to adjust the airspeed according to different tasks, from delicate flower beds to heavy debris. This feature provides versatility, ensuring that the blower can be used effectively in various environments.
  • Durability and Build Quality: High-quality materials and construction contribute to the longevity of a petrol leaf blower. Look for models with robust housings and components that can withstand the rigors of regular use in different weather conditions.
  • Ease of Start Mechanism: An easy start mechanism, such as a primer bulb or a recoil starter, simplifies the ignition process. This feature is particularly important for users who want to minimize the time spent preparing the blower before use.
  • Noise Reduction Technology: Advanced noise reduction features can make a petrol leaf blower more user-friendly, especially in residential areas. Quieter operation is increasingly important for compliance with local noise ordinances and for the comfort of users and neighbors.
  • Fuel Efficiency: A petrol leaf blower with good fuel efficiency reduces operational costs and increases runtime. Models that utilize advanced engine technology can often provide more power while consuming less fuel, making them environmentally friendly options.
  • Comfortable Grip and Controls: Ergonomic designs with comfortable grips and easily accessible controls enhance user comfort and control during operation. This feature is essential for reducing strain on the hands and arms, especially during prolonged use.

What Should You Look for When Selecting the Ideal Petrol Leaf Blower?

When selecting the ideal petrol leaf blower, several key factors should be considered to ensure optimal performance and user satisfaction.

  • Power Rating: Look for a petrol leaf blower with a high power rating measured in cubic centimeters (cc) or horsepower (HP), as this directly influences its ability to move leaves and debris efficiently. A blower with at least 25cc is typically suitable for residential use, while larger models are better for extensive areas.
  • Air Volume and Speed: The air volume (measured in cubic feet per minute, CFM) and air speed (measured in miles per hour, MPH) are crucial metrics. A higher CFM indicates a more powerful blower that can move a larger amount of debris, while higher MPH helps in dislodging stubborn leaves and dirt.
  • Weight and Ergonomics: Consider the weight of the leaf blower, especially if you’ll be using it for extended periods. A lighter model will reduce fatigue, and ergonomic designs with cushioned handles help improve comfort and control during operation.
  • Fuel Efficiency: Choose a model that offers good fuel efficiency, as this will save you money on fuel in the long run. Look for blowers that have a larger fuel tank, which allows for longer run times between refueling.
  • Noise Level: Petrol leaf blowers can be quite loud, so check the decibel (dB) rating. Models designed with noise reduction technology are preferable, especially if you live in a noise-sensitive area or plan to use the blower frequently.
  • Maintenance Requirements: Consider the maintenance needs of the blower, including how easy it is to access the air filter and spark plug. Models that require less frequent maintenance or have user-friendly maintenance features can save you time and effort.
  • Brand Reputation and Warranty: Research reputable brands known for producing reliable and durable leaf blowers. A good warranty can also provide peace of mind, ensuring that you are protected against manufacturing defects and issues that may arise over time.

Why Is Engine Power Critical to Performance in Petrol Leaf Blowers?

Engine power significantly influences the performance of petrol leaf blowers, affecting efficiency, blowing capacity, and overall usability. Here are key reasons why engine power is critical:

  • Air Velocity and Volume: A powerful engine generates higher air velocity, which is essential for moving heavy debris like wet leaves and twigs. Typical petrol leaf blowers reach air speeds of 150 to 250 mph, with stronger engines enabling efficient clearing even in challenging conditions.

  • Endurance and Reliability: Higher engine power often translates to greater durability and the ability to perform long tasks without overheating. This is especially important for commercial users who rely on consistent performance throughout the day.

  • Versatility: With robust engine power, leaf blowers can handle multiple functions beyond just blowing leaves, like clearing pathways or yards. Users can switch attachments for mulching or vacuuming, making the tool more versatile.

  • Time Efficiency: A leaf blower with adequate engine power can complete tasks more quickly, saving time. A powerful blower can clear a large garden in a fraction of the time it would take with a less powerful model, enhancing productivity.

When choosing a petrol leaf blower, it’s crucial to consider engine power to ensure it meets specific needs and yard conditions effectively.

Which Brands Are Renowned for Producing the Best Petrol Leaf Blowers?

Several brands are renowned for producing the best petrol leaf blowers, known for their performance, durability, and user-friendly features.

  • Stihl: Stihl is a leading brand in the outdoor power equipment industry, particularly recognized for its reliable petrol leaf blowers. Their models, such as the Stihl BG 86, offer powerful engines and ergonomic designs, making them easy to operate for extended periods, which is ideal for both homeowners and professionals.
  • Husqvarna: Husqvarna is another top contender, known for its innovative technology and robust construction. Their 350BT model features a backpack design that distributes weight evenly, allowing users to handle larger tasks with reduced fatigue, while the efficient engine delivers high airspeed for effective debris removal.
  • Echo: Echo has built a reputation for high-performance leaf blowers with durable build quality and efficient engines. The Echo PB-580T is a popular choice, boasting a powerful 58.2cc engine and a comfortable ergonomic design, making it suitable for both residential and commercial use.
  • Makita: Makita is known for its commitment to quality and performance in outdoor equipment, with their petrol leaf blowers providing excellent power-to-weight ratios. The Makita EB7660TH, for example, features a unique 4-stroke engine that reduces emissions while ensuring high performance, making it an eco-friendly option.
  • Redmax: Redmax offers a range of efficient and powerful leaf blowers that cater to both professional landscapers and homeowners. Their Redmax EBZ8500 model is recognized for its high air volume and speed, making it effective for heavy-duty clearing tasks, while also ensuring user comfort during operation.

How Can You Maintain Your Petrol Leaf Blower for Optimal Performance?

To maintain your petrol leaf blower for optimal performance, consider the following tips:

  • Regular Cleaning: Keeping the blower clean helps prevent debris buildup that can affect performance.
  • Fuel Quality: Using high-quality fuel ensures better combustion and reduces the risk of engine problems.
  • Oil Maintenance: Regularly checking and changing the engine oil is crucial for lubrication and to prevent wear.
  • Filter Care: Cleaning or replacing air and fuel filters aids in maintaining efficient airflow and fuel delivery.
  • Spark Plug Inspection: Checking the spark plug ensures proper ignition and can improve starting and efficiency.

Regular cleaning involves removing any leaves, dirt, or debris from both the exterior and the interior components of the blower. This not only enhances performance but also prolongs the lifespan of the equipment.

Fuel quality plays a significant role in the operation of a petrol leaf blower. Using fuel that meets the manufacturer’s specifications can help avoid engine knocking and ensure smoother operation.

Oil maintenance is essential for the engine’s health. By routinely checking and changing the oil according to the manufacturer’s recommendations, you help to maintain optimal lubrication, which minimizes wear and extends the life of the engine.

Filter care is vital for maintaining airflow and fuel efficiency. Regularly cleaning or replacing air and fuel filters prevents clogs that can lead to engine inefficiency and ensures that the blower operates at its best.

Inspecting the spark plug is important to ensure that the engine starts easily and runs smoothly. A worn or dirty spark plug can lead to starting issues and decreased performance, so it should be checked and replaced as needed.

What Techniques Can You Use to Maximize Efficiency When Using a Petrol Leaf Blower?

To maximize efficiency when using a petrol leaf blower, several techniques can be employed:

  • Proper Maintenance: Regularly check and maintain your petrol leaf blower to ensure it operates at peak performance.
  • Adjusting Airflow: Tailor the blower’s airflow settings according to the type of debris and the area being cleared.
  • Optimal Starting Technique: Use the correct starting procedure to ensure quick and effective ignition before use.
  • Efficient Blowing Technique: Utilize effective body positioning and movement patterns to enhance debris collection.
  • Timing and Weather Considerations: Choose the right time and weather conditions for leaf blowing to improve efficiency.

Proper Maintenance: Regularly checking the oil levels, spark plugs, and air filters can significantly enhance the performance of your petrol leaf blower. Ensuring that the equipment is clean and well-maintained prevents any operational issues and prolongs its lifespan, allowing it to work more effectively.

Adjusting Airflow: Different types of debris require different airflow settings; for instance, heavy wet leaves may need a stronger setting than dry leaves. Adjusting the blower’s throttle can help you optimize the blowing power and conserve fuel while achieving better results.

Optimal Starting Technique: Familiarize yourself with the correct starting steps for your specific model, as improper starting can lead to performance issues. Often, a proper prime and choke setting can make starting easier and quicker, ensuring you spend less time preparing and more time blowing leaves.

Efficient Blowing Technique: Positioning your body to move with the wind and using a sweeping motion can help gather more leaves in less time. Additionally, maintaining a consistent distance from the ground will ensure that debris is effectively moved without scattering it unnecessarily.

Timing and Weather Considerations: Leaf blowing is most effective on dry days when leaves are less likely to stick to surfaces. Choosing early morning or late afternoon can also help avoid peak wind conditions, making it easier to control the direction of the leaves being blown.
